Beautiful bluebird powder skiing in the Flute/Oboe area today. Our party of 5 tracked out the east slopes of Oboe leaving the west side untracked just to be nice. Flute backside was tracked out in centre. There's untracked snow on the north slopes off Lesser Flute and on the southern side of the slopes.
180cms HS in a test pit on E facing slope - 32 degrees steep.
10cms fist on top of 10cms 4F. Then about 75cms of dense pencil snow that is pretty much consolidated. Got the 20cms layer to react to compression test CTH 24 - but not a sudden planar/clean shear.
Basically it looked good stability wise. Some surface hoar forming - maybe 1 - 2cms.
No reaction to ski cuts on N slopes or to ski cuts on w/l NE slopes. Was good to get out in old familiar area again.

According to Whistler as of this evening, they are not planning to open the upper lifts for the balance of the week. Absent the upper lifts, what's the best way to Flute from the Roundhouse?

I skinned from the Gondola to top of Harmony Chair then over to symphony Bow and over to flute and over.
